Problems solved by technology

[0004] First of all, the track is linear, and the installation position of the luminaire can only be changed in the fixed linear position, and the luminaire cannot be adjusted and installed in a space other than this; but such a demand is required in museums with high requirements for lighting effects. Halls and other spaces are very common
For example, in a certain space, due to application requirements, a track was originally installed at a distance of 1m from the wall, and the lighting effect was good when the lamps were installed on this track. The position of the wall at 1.5m; at this time, the original track obviously cannot be realized, and secondary construction must be carried out, which is very inconvenient and consumes a lot of time and cost
[0005] Secondly, due to various reasons, there is no power device and cannot be installed in the track system. The position change of the lamps on the track needs to be manually operated. The lamps installed on the ceiling, especially some lamps with a space of more than 10 meters, need to be manually operated. It is also a complicated and dangerous process, which also brings a lot of manpower, material resources and time consumption.
[0006] Again, because the power and signal in the track system are on the same road, the power and signal obtained by each lamp are the same, so it is almost impossible to individually control each lamp, such as individually switching a lamp, Adjust brightness, etc., especially for lamps without drivers and non-digital intelligent drivers, it is impossible to achieve individual control
[0007] In summary, the existing intelligent lighting layout and control technology obviously has inconvenience and defects in actual use, so it is necessary to improve it

Abstract

The invention relates to the lighting technical field and provides an intelligent lighting arrangement and control system. The system comprises a coordinate type grooved guide rail frame, a system controller and mobile terminal modules; the coordinate type grooved guide rail frame is latticed and is composed of a plurality of guide rail assemblies, wherein each guide rail assembly includes a terminal unit module; the system controller is connected with the coordinate type grooved guide rail frame and receives control signals transmitted by an external control terminal and parses the control signals and transmits the parsed control signals to the terminal unit modules; the interfaces of the mobile terminal modules are provided with lighting lamps; the mobile terminal modules are arranged on the coordinate type grooved guide rail frame, and are controlled by control instructions which are obtained by the terminal unit modules due to the parsing of the control signals; and the lighting lamps can be moved on the plurality of guide rail assemblies, or irradiation parameters of the lighting lamps can be adjusted on the plurality of guide rail assemblies. The lattice coordinate type intelligent lighting arrangement and control system has the advantages of simple structure, convenient installation, debugging operation and stable performance. With the intelligent lighting arrangement and control system adopted, the efficient automation of the position adjustment of the lamps can be realized, and inconvenience caused by lamp light debugging can be reduced.

Description

technical field [0001] The invention relates to the technical field of lighting, in particular to an intelligent lighting arrangement and control system. Background technique [0002] At present, the lighting track system and track lights are considered the most convenient and flexible lighting arrangement and installation scheme. Several wires are arranged on a straight or curved track for power and signal transmission, and rail clips that match the track ( Or track head) lamps can be fixed at any position of the track through the bayonet structure of the rail clamp, and connected with the wires of the track through the contact parts on the rail clamp to realize the connection with the power system and control system to achieve flexible lighting The purpose of the layout, such as figure 1 shown.
